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ky

Domáce Hardware Siete Programovanie Softvér Otázka Systémy

Ako znížiť počet znakov v reťazci na PHP

Použitie PHP skripty , môžete modelovať postupností textových znakov ako reťazce . Jazyk PHP funkcie pre manipuláciu reťazca , napríklad vrátiť časť väčšieho reťazca ako ďalší hodnotu reťazca . Ak chcete znížiť počet znakov v reťazci , môžete použiť funkciu podreťazec vytvoriť kópiu z týchto znakov , ktoré chcete udržať v rámci reťazca . Môžete si zvoliť , aby sa pôvodný reťazec okrem zníženej jeden , alebo môžete jednoducho nahradiť pôvodnú reťazec s skrátenej verzii . Pokyny dovolená 1

Pripravte reťazec vo Vašom PHP skriptu . Nasledujúca ukážka PHP kód demonštruje vytvorenie reťazcové premenné s nejakým ľubovoľným textom uloženým v ňom :

$ my_text = " Tu je obsah textu " ;

Váš vlastný reťazec môže obsahovať akékoľvek znaky , ktoré sa vám páčia , vrátane písmen , čísel a interpunkčných symbolov . Môžete si vybrať ľubovoľný názov premennej pre váš reťazec , pokiaľ to dáva zmysel a je platný názov v jazyku .
2

Vykonajte proces podreťazec na povrázku . Funkcie podreťazec má parametre , ktoré predstavujú pôvodnú reťazec , pozície začať operáciu a dĺžku požadovanej časti reťazca . Rozhodnite sa , aký Dĺžka chcete , aby váš nový reťazec bude a akú pozíciu budete chcieť začať v rámci existujúcej reťazec , pretože si spomenula , že prvé pozície znaku v reťazci je nulová . Použite nasledujúcu štruktúru syntaxe vykonávať operácie podreťazec na reťazcové premenné :

substr ( $ my_text , 0 , 10 ) ;

Tento príklad skopíruje prvých 10 znakov z pôvodného reťazca premennej .
3

Uložte si novú sekciu string ako premenná . Ak chcete zachovať váš pôvodný reťazec premenné , môžete uložiť novú časť ako samostatná premenná o zmene kódu takto :

$ text_section = substr ( $ my_text , 0 , 10 ) ;

Funkcia podreťazec vráti požadovanú časť reťazca , takže tento riadok ukladá vrátenú hodnotu reťazca ako premenné . Ak nechcete , aby sa vaše pôvodné reťazec , môžete ju nahradiť tým , že zmení kód takto :

$ my_text = substr ( $ my_text , 0 , 10 ) ;

Akonáhle tento riadok bol popravený , bude váš string premenná obsahovať len znaky uvedené ako parametre funkciu podreťazec .
4

Použite svoje nové reťazcové premenné v skripte . Môžete odkazovať na nový reťazec na každej trati , po operácii podreťazec , ako by ste s akoukoľvek inou premennou . Napríklad nasledujúci riadok kódu napísať nové reťazcové premenné do prehliadača ako súčasť štruktúry HTML :

echo "

" $ text_section " < /p > " ; < .. br >

vykonávajte bez ohľadu na spracovanie vaše webové stránky alebo aplikácia vyžaduje vášho nového reťazca .
5

Uložte PHP skript , nahrať súbor na webový server a prejdite na stránku to vyskúšať . Ak si len chcete overiť , že operácia podreťazec pracoval , napísať nový reťazec s použitím príkazu echo . Ak kód nefunguje , ako ste očakávali , že sa , skontrolovať podreťazec parametrov funkcie a uistite sa , že sú okolo správne hodnoty pre počiatočnú pozíciu a dĺžku . Experiment s kódom , kým robí to , čo budete potrebovať , aby to .

Najnovšie články

Copyright © počítačové znalosti Všetky práva vyhradené